Primary fields of research

Structural analysis of proteins in solution with a focus on the fibrillation porcess, leading to amyloids and amyloid-like structures. As part of the BioSAXS group, small-angle X-ray scattering (SAXS) is the main method applied to obtain structural information. Often omplementary analysis is required, ranging various biophysical  techniques, but also e.g. transmission electron microscopy (TEM) and fibre diffraction.
